Originally Posted by questor
Is this bag waterproof? Not sure what "water-, and weather-resistant" means.

It does come with a rain cover in which I have never used even though being caught in some heavy down pours. I believe most bags regardless of brand can not be completely water proof. I do however use freezer bags when protecting my valuables like digital cameras etc. because sh*t happens......
